Starmer’s place is ‘untenable’ after Mandelson ‘catastrophe’, senior Tory argues
Keir Starmer’s place as prime minister is "untenable", Alex Burghart, the Conservative Party’s shadow Cabinet Office chief has stated.
He highlighted what he referred to as "the most dramatic piece of evidence" towards Starmer, his admission at Prime Minister’s Questions that "he knew that Peter Mandelson had an ongoing relationship with the paedophile Jeffrey Epstein when he appointed him to be ambassador in Washington".
Burghart added: "I’ve never thought he was fit to be prime minister. What I’m saying now is that I don’t think his position is politically tenable."
